چکیده :
Electricity energy imbalance refers to the imbalance between electricity supply and demand. One of the main solutions to solve this challenge is utilization of photovoltaic power plants. The present study examines the thermo-economic analysis and comparison of bifacial and monofacial modules in a 3 MW grid-connected solar power with utilizing PVsyst software plant under conditionof the Khomein County, Iran. Results shows that the yearly energy injected into the grid using monofacial modules is 5706.53 MWh, with a daily average of 15.6 MWh, and using bifacial panels, is 6105.47 MWh, with a daily average of 16.7 MWh. The payback period for monofacial and bifacial modes is 3.5 and 3.2 years, respectively. Also, the levelized cost of energy is 0.020 and 0.019, respectively. The energy production and net revenue with bifacial modules is about 7% higher than monofacial modules.
